Runs the StopProgram with the specified parameters in the context of the specified user.
If you specify the MonitorProgram, the agent executes the user-defined MonitorProgram in the user-specified context. If you specify PidFiles, the routine verifies that the process ID found in each listed file is running. If you specify MonitorProcesses, the routine verifies that each listed process is running in the context you specify.
Use any one, two, or three of these attributes to monitor the application.
If any one process specified in either PidFiles or MonitorProcesses is determined not to be running, the monitor returns offline. If the process terminates ungracefully, the monitor returns offline and failover occurs.
Terminates processes specified in PidFiles or MonitorProcesses. Ensures that only those processes (specified in MonitorProcesses) running with the user ID specified in the User attribute are killed. If the CleanProgram is defined, the agent executes the CleanProgram.
